Operational Excellence Engineer
As an Operational Excellence Engineer you will be responsible for driving operational excellence to deliver year-over-year improvements in cost and productivity. This role is responsible for translating key Company and FPP (Full Potential Plan) initiatives into action for the Operations function, and the implementation of key KPIs related to cost, maintenance, automation, reliability, etc. This role will be aligned with the Operational & Engineering Center of Excellence and will have a dotted line responsibility to the local Plant Leader.

It is expected that this role will be able to offset inflation as a minimum expectation within its respective facility.

Essential Functions & Requirements:

  • Prioritizes health and safety by adhering to policies, processes, and maintaining safe practices at all times
  • Actively reviews practices, workflows and systems to identify opportunities and advises on appropriate interventions for process improvements that impact production and business results; champions waste eliminations and reductions
  • Designs, develops, and implements effective solutions to improve operational efficiency and reduce costs, including creating and updating process documentation and workflows, and ensuring they are sustained by the business
  • Drives improvement projects across various departments, utilizing standardized OPEX tools and methods to enhance performance and maximize EBITDA
  • Facilitates change management by engaging with cross-functional teams to foster a culture of continuous improvement and provides training and support to employees at all levels to encourage the adoption of new processes and tools
  • Promotes a safety-first culture by incorporating health and safety considerations into all process improvements
  • Incorporates data analysis and problem solving through lean manufacturing methodologies, DMAIC, Value Stream Maps, 5-Why, Ishikawa diagrams, FMEAs and/or Kaizen to investigate issues and performance drivers to establish robust action plans
  • Drives knowledge exchange with technology experts (plant resources, engineering solutions, internal/external consultant groups, sister plants, etc.) to increase awareness of potential improvement opportunities
  • Encourages innovative thinking and explores new technologies or methodologies that could further enhance operational excellence within the Company
  • Trains and coaches employees on operational excellence principles and methodologies
  • Monitors the effectiveness of implemented initiatives and makes necessary adjustments
  • Creates and presents reports on FPP initiatives and their impact to leadership
  • Utilizes project management principles to complete oversight and management of capital, plant and cost reduction projects
  • Conducts root cause analysis and implements corrective actions for process-related concerns
  • Reduces use of assumptions and expands use of support data for effective decision making
  • Takes on additional duties as assigned to support the team and organization

Education:

  • Bachelor's degree in engineering (required)
  • Six Sigma Black Belt certification (preferred)

Experience:

  • 10+ years of proven experience in engineering, maintenance, reliability, project management, Six Sigma/LEAN, productivity or continuous improvement roles (required)

Competencies:

  • Results oriented, with the ability to gather, analyze, and interpret information from a variety of sources
  • Ability to see the big picture, translating details into an organizational perspective
  • Ability to develop and track KPIs for operational excellence initiatives
  • Strong problem-solving skills with a data-driven approach to identifying and resolving issues
  • Strong attention to detail and precision in analyzing data, implementing improvements, and documenting results
  • Excellent leadership and team management skills, with a strong ability to drive cross-functional initiatives
  • Proficiency in tools such as PowerBI, Visio, Microsoft Office Suite, data analysis software (e.g., Minitab, Excel), ERP systems, and knowledge of statistical process control (SPC)
